The Executive Director, Global Patient Safety Sciences Delivery serves as the key point of contact for all Safety Sciences operations and risk related responsibilities across all Therapeutic Areas (TAs). This role is responsible for driving consistency across the portfolio for standard activities performed by the Safety Scientists (e.g., data transformation, safety surveillance, SMT preparation, early draft of aggregate reports, signal evaluations, label enhancement justifications). This role is also responsible for the processes and written procedures that underpin the safety governance, and other fundamental processes within Safety Sciences. The Executive Director, Global Patient Safety Sciences Delivery requires the ability to work cross functionally, partnering with the Safety Sciences TAHs and other leaders, and will serve as a member of the GPS Leadership Team (GPS LT). The Executive Director is also responsible for the development and management of their team.

- Define the strategy to ensure standardization and consistency in execution of core activities (e.g., signal detection, authoring sections for safety documents) across all products and TAs through development of common practices, processes and templates.
- Oversee relevant training programs for GPS Safety Sciences, including a standardized training curriculum, proficiency matrix and knowledge management repository.
- Enable the Global Capability Center (GCC) to operate more efficiently and scale with the demands of the business.
- Develop innovative approaches to delivering core activities that integrate new technologies, including AI.
- Ensure compliance and quality management of Safety Sciences Operations activities, including compliance with all regulations and establishment of SOPs and associated monitoring tools.
- Oversee all aspects of signal detection coordination and signal management process across all TAs, including Safety Monitoring Team (SMT), Safety Surveillance Plan (SSP) and Signal Evaluation Report (SER).
- Coordinate and support high quality, timely and compliant delivery of benefit risk assessment for periodic safety reports (e.g., DSURs, PSURs) and support Safety Sciences Strategy in contributing Medical and Safety perspective to the GPS portfolio of documents (e.g., ARM, RMP, SMP) where required.
- Set and oversee the framework for aggregate safety data analysis to ensure effective coordination and delivery.
- Serve as strategic point of contact to enable SS operational delivery in partnership with TAHs and GPS Leads.
- Partner with key Regeneron interfaces (e.g., Clinical, Regulatory, Med Affairs, Biostats & Data Management).
